Window¶
A window for displaying components to the user
Usage¶
The window class is used for desktop applications, where components need to be shown within a window-manager. Windows can be configured on instantiation and support displaying multiple widgets, toolbars and resizing.
import toga
window = toga.Window('my window', title='This is a window!')
window.show()

Reference¶
-
class
toga.interface.window.
Window
(id_=None, title=None, position=(100, 100), size=(640, 480), resizeable=True, closeable=True, minimizable=True)¶ Instantiates a window
Parameters: - id (
str
) – The ID of the window (optional) - title (
str
) – Title for the window (optional) - position (
tuple
of (int
,int
)) – Position of the window, as x,y coordinates - size (
tuple
of (int
,int
)) – Size of the window, as (width, height) sizes, in pixels - resizable (
bool
) – Toggle if the window is resizable by the user, defaults to True. - closable (
bool
) – Toggle if the window is closable by the user, defaults to True. - minimizable (
bool
) – Toggle if the window is minimizable by the user, defaults to True.
